Do They Understand the Consumer Product Safety Improvement Act (CPSIA)?
CPSIA is the foundation of U.S. toy safety compliance.
A factory supplying the U.S. market should understand that CPSIA requires:
- Lead content limits
- Phthalate restrictions
- Mandatory third-party testing
- Tracking label requirements
If a supplier is unfamiliar with CPSIA terminology, that is a major warning sign.
Are They Familiar With ASTM F963 Standards?
ASTM F963 is the primary toy safety standard referenced by U.S. law.
For plush toys, relevant areas include:
- Mechanical and physical testing
- Flammability requirements
- Chemical substance limits
- Small parts testing

Do They Work With CPSC-Accepted Testing Laboratories?
Under CPSIA, children’s products must be tested by CPSC-accepted third-party laboratories.
Reliable manufacturers typically:
- Cooperate with recognized labs
- Understand required sample preparation
- Plan testing timelines before shipment
- Review product risk points prior to submission
If a supplier cannot identify CPSC-accepted labs or testing workflow, export risk increases significantly.
Do They Understand Children’s Product Certification (CPC) Requirements?
For U.S. compliance, importers must issue a Children’s Product Certificate (CPC) based on valid lab testing.
A knowledgeable factory should:
- Provide test data to support CPC issuance
- Understand product-specific testing scope
- Maintain documentation for traceability

Do They Understand Age Grading and Product Classification?
Under U.S. law, toys are categorized based on intended age group.
For plush toys, this affects:
- Small parts evaluation
- Labeling requirements
- Mechanical safety thresholds
- Marketing positioning
A knowledgeable factory should ask:
- Is this product for children under 3?
- Does it contain detachable components?
- Is it considered a “children’s product” under CPSIA?
If age grading is not discussed early, compliance risks increase.

How Do They Control Lead Content and Phthalate Risks?

Under CPSIA, strict limits apply to:
- Lead content in substrates and surface coatings
- Phthalates in plastics and certain materials
For plush toys entering the U.S. market, chemical compliance is not optional—and violations can result in serious legal consequences.
Do They Understand Where Lead Risks May Appear?
Lead risks may exist in:
- Printed decorations
- Dyed fabrics
- Painted plastic eyes or noses
- Metallic accessories
- Zippers or decorative trims
A reliable factory should understand that lead testing is required for accessible parts and coatings, not just for the main fabric.
If lead compliance is treated casually, your product is exposed to significant regulatory risk.
Are Phthalate Risks Managed in Plastic Components?
Phthalates are often found in:
- PVC accessories
- Soft plastic trims
- Flexible decorative parts
Under CPSIA, specific phthalates are restricted for children’s products.

Are Tracking Labels and Product Traceability Properly Managed?

Under CPSIA, children’s products sold in the U.S. must include tracking label information.
This is not optional—it is a legal requirement.
Tracking labels help identify when and where a product was made in case of recalls or safety investigations.
Do They Understand CPSIA Tracking Label Requirements?
Tracking labels must typically include:
- Manufacturer or private labeler name
- Production date
- Batch or lot number
- Location of production
- Other identifying marks for traceability
A reliable factory should understand how to:
- Integrate tracking information into sewn labels
- Print batch codes on packaging
- Maintain internal production records
If tracking labels are treated as a last-minute addition, compliance risk increases.
Is There a Structured Batch Record System?
Traceability requires:
- Batch-level production records
- Material sourcing documentation
- Shipment lot tracking
- Testing documentation storage

Can They Provide Valid U.S.-Compliant Lab Test Reports?

In the U.S. market, compliance is documentation-driven.
Saying “we passed before” is not enough.
Each product configuration requires valid, product-specific testing conducted by a CPSC-accepted laboratory.
Are the Test Reports Recent and Product-Specific?
A strong U.S.-ready factory should be able to provide:
- ASTM F963 testing reports
- CPSIA lead and phthalate testing results
- Testing performed by CPSC-accepted labs
- Reports issued within a reasonable timeframe
Generic or outdated reports do not guarantee compliance for your product.
A reliable supplier will clarify that final testing must be conducted on the actual production sample—not rely solely on past reports.
Do They Understand That Testing Depends on Product Configuration?
U.S. compliance is configuration-based.
Changes that may require re-testing include:
- Adding magnets
- Changing fabric dyes
- Modifying plastic components
- Introducing detachable accessories
